C# 中Console.Writeline();与write用法和源代码
的有关信息介绍如下:C# 中Console.Writeline(); 和 Console.Write();两种输出的用法和对比
//Console.Write()的用法
Console.WriteLine("\n使用write进行输出");
Console.Write("a");
Console.Write("a{0}");
Console.Write("a={0}");
Console.Write("a=");
Console.Write(a);
Console.Write(" write不会自动换行");
/* Console.Write("a");
Console.Write(a); 输出也为a=10 */
Console.Readline();
//Console.WriteLine()的用法:
Console.Write("");//必须至少一个参数以上。加上""无输入也可以
Console.WriteLine();//有无参数均可,即()内可为空
/*Console.Write();//必须至少一个参数以上。
Console.WriteLine();//有无参数均可*/
int a=10;
Console.WriteLine("使用writeline进行输出");
Console.WriteLine("a");
Console.WriteLine("a{0}", a);
Console.WriteLine("a={0}", a);
Console.WriteLine("输出a的值:{0}", a);
Console.WriteLine("a=");
Console.WriteLine("{0}");
/*与后面的:
* Console.Write("a="); Console.Write(a); 形成对比,writeline会自动换行*/
复制并运行后,发现:WriteLine有自动换行的功能,而write并没有。